ID Please

This piece was sold to me as a chalice. I cant find a head. Its mounted on a really jagged surface of rock. I tried to get a good pic. Is it a chalice? If so any name? It has great color. The piece in the center of the image. Taken through my costa del mar 580g sunglasses.

Looks like a chalice to me. It's skin has just receded some.
It does look a lot like a chalice. Hard to tell what kind till it grows out. I just got a frag from kthomas that looks like this one, but mine has yellow eyes a.